Ingredients for Chicken Fajita Skillet

Gathering the right ingredients is the first step to creating this delicious Chicken Fajita Skillet. Here’s what you’ll need:

  • 1 lb chicken breast, sliced: Tender and juicy, sliced chicken breast is the star of the dish.
  • 1 red bell pepper, sliced: Adds a sweet crunch and beautiful color.
  • 1 green bell pepper, sliced: Brings a slightly tangy flavor that balances the sweetness of the red pepper.
  • 1 onion, sliced: A must for that lovely aromatic base; I usually prefer yellow or sweet onions.
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il: For sautéing the chicken and vegetables; it adds a delicious richness!
  • 1 teaspoon chili powder: Adds a warm, spicy kick to the dish.
  • 1 teaspoon cumin: Gives a lovely earthy flavor that’s essential in fajitas.
  • Salt and pepper to taste: Essential for enhancing all the flavors.
  • Tortillas for serving: Don’t forget the tortillas! They’re perfect for scooping up all that flavorful goodness.

How to Prepare Chicken Fajita Skillet

Getting ready to whip up this Chicken Fajita Skillet is super straightforward, and I promise you’ll love how quickly it comes together! Follow these simple steps, and you’ll have a delicious meal in no time.

Step 1: Heat the Olive Oil

First things first, grab your skillet and heat up the 2 tablespoons of olive oil over medium heat. Preheating is key here—it ensures that the chicken gets that beautiful golden-brown color. You’ll want the oil to shimmer a bit before adding anything in, so keep an eye on it!

Step 2: Cook the Chicken

Once the oil is hot, toss in the sliced chicken breast. Cook it for about 5-7 minutes, stirring occasionally, until it’s browned on the outside and cooked through. You’ll know it’s ready when there’s no pink left inside and it smells absolutely divine!

Step 3: Add Vegetables

Now, it’s time to add in the sliced red and green bell peppers and the onion. Stir everything together and let it cook for another 5 minutes. You want those veggies to soften up nicely and soak in all the flavors from the chicken. The colors will be so vibrant, you won’t be able to resist!

Step 4: Add Spices

Next, sprinkle in the 1 teaspoon of chili powder and 1 teaspoon of cumin. Stir them into the mix for about a minute so the spices can release their incredible aroma and flavor. Trust me, this step makes all the difference!

Step 5: Season and Serve

Finally, season with salt and pepper to taste. Give everything a good stir, and it’s ready to serve! Pair it with warm tortillas for scooping up all that fantastic flavor. You can even add your favorite toppings like cheese or sour cream if you’d like!

Storage & Reheating Instructions

So, you’ve made a delicious Chicken Fajita Skillet and have some leftovers? Don’t worry, I’ve got you covered! Storing this meal properly will keep it fresh and tasty for a few days.

First off, let the skillet cool down a bit before transferring the leftovers to an airtight container. I usually divide it into smaller portions; that way, it’s easy to grab when you need a quick meal. You can keep it in the fridge for up to 3-4 days. Just make sure to seal it well—nobody wants soggy fajitas!

When it comes time to enjoy those leftovers, the best way to reheat them is on the stovetop. Just toss the fajita mixture in a skillet over medium heat, stirring occasionally until it’s heated through. It should take about 5-7 minutes. If you want to add a splash of water or broth, feel free; it’ll help keep everything nice and moist!

Alternatively, you can use the microwave if you’re in a hurry. Just pop it in a microwave-safe dish, cover it with a lid or microwave-safe wrap (to prevent any splatters), and heat it in 30-second intervals, stirring in between until warmed to your liking.

Chicken Fajita Skillet

Chicken Fajita Skillet: 25-Minute Flavor Explosion


  • Author: Louna
  • Total Time: 25 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x
  • Diet: Low Calorie

Description

A quick and easy one-pan meal featuring chicken, bell peppers, and spices.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 lb chicken breast, sliced
  • 1 red bell pepper, sliced
  • 1 green bell pepper, sliced
  • 1 onion, sliced
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on chili powder
  • 1 teaspoon cumin
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Tortillas for serving

Instructions

  1.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at.
  2. Add sliced chicken and cook until browned.
  3. Add bell peppers and onion to the skillet.
  4. Stir in chili powder and cumin.
  5. Cook until vegetables are tender.
  6. Season with salt and pepper.
  7. Serve with tortillas.
